Home

Here is the Product/Service you selected:

YO-ZURI-Leader-Yo-Zuri-TKLD30LBNCL30 1221-3955 / 19139476

YO-ZURI-Leader-Yo-Zuri-TKLD30LBNCL30
Manufacturer’s Part Number: 1221-3955 / 19139476

Our Low Price: $20.10

Click here for more information and/or to order.

YO-ZURI-Leader-Yo-Zuri-TKLD30LBNCL30
Manufacturer’s Part Number: 1221-3955 / 19139476